> (EDIT: Applied in Perl OO one gets private class-variables in package scope instead of public package variables!) lets elaborate, in the following code you can see a simplified standard Perl class with private and public variables and methods. The private data is only visible and accessible within the methods because of Perl's closure mechanism.
